Job DescriptionDear Candidate, Greetings of the day! We are Hiring for Tech Lead – Java spring boot We are an impact sourcing company based out of India, focused on three key verticals: BPM, Tech and Consulting. Being recognized as “A company to watch out in 2020” by IAOP, at the Outsourcing World Summit, we are focused on building and delivering Solution and efficiency-oriented approach to our customers, in the area of Digital Transformation, Contact Centre, AI/ML enablement, etc. Must have : 5+ years of software engineering experience, including solid understanding of standard data structuresand algorithms Expert-level knowledge of ReactJS ecosystem. Experience working with MongoDB. Demonstrated experience in B2B cloud application/SaaS development for large enterprises Ability to design and architect systems based on Java Spring Boot Microservice and ReactJS Experience writing unit tests. Proficient understanding of build tools and code versioning tools, such as Git/SVN Good understanding of browser rendering behaviour and performance Demonstrated understanding of asynchronous request handling, partial page updates, and AJAX Ability to review specifications documents and provide technical inputs on successfully implementingbusiness solutions Good understanding of browser development tools and performance optimization Understanding Code Quality Metrics Ability to work independently or with a team and lead a project to completion Self-motivated with outstanding interpersonal skills, strong work ethic, and excellent communicationand presentation skills Experience working with Docker and Kubernetes 2-3 years. Experience working with cloud platforms like GCP, Azure or AWS is a plus. Education/Experience Responsibilities : Works with product team to understand project requirementsBuild reusable code and libraries for future useOptimize applications for maximum speed and scalabilityTechnical documentation Designing architecture, flow diagrams, documenting technical implementation approaches and pseudo codeEnsure the technical feasibility of UI/UX designDevice strategies, or innovative approaches that have significant impact on the application designSet and evolve standards and best practices for our application development team Conduct code reviews and enforce standardsOversee development process compliance and CI/CD activitiesGuide/Mentor junior developers and empowering them on ReactJS and related trends. Good to have: Cross-Platform Mobile development for Apple and AndroidAuthentication with tokens utilizing technologies such as OAuth, SSOBuilding REST API or other server tools with backed technologies, such as Node, Java, etc.Experience Working on Agile Teams and using Application Lifecycle Management tools like JIRA. Regards, HR Team Employement Category:Employement Type: Full timeIndustry: Recruitment Services Role Category: General / Other Software Functional Area: Not ApplicableRole/Responsibilies: Tech Lead – Java spring bootContact Details:Company: Gfl RecruitmentLocation(s): Udaipur
Keyskills:
java
jira
node
ui/ux design